/* larger wrapper */
.large-wrapper.header{
	    max-width: 100%;
    margin: auto;
    padding: 0 30px;
    width: 100%;
    position: relative;
}

/* custom billboard transform*/
.billboard .slider-parallax .swiper-slide.alt{
	max-height:35vh;
}
.secondarybillboard .slider-parallax .swiper-slide img{
	top:-200% !important;
}
/* custom texture */
.star{color:black !important}

/* custom buttons */
input[type="button"],.custbut,#custbut,.wpcf7-form-control.wpcf7-submit,#leaveAreview .custbut,.blog article .btn{border-radius:3px;transition: all ease .25s;color:white;cursor:pointer;padding: .8rem 1.5rem;display: inline-block;text-decoration: none;font-size: 1.05em;text-decoration:none;background-color:#0E4883;text-transform:uppercase;text-align:center;font-weight: normal;font-size: 1em;letter-spacing:.1em;box-shadow:0 0 1rem rgba(0,0,0,.35);border:none;}

#footer .textwidget .custbut{min-width:75%;}
.paraone.bk.feed{min-height:65vh;display:flex;align-items:center;justify-content:center;}

input[type="button"],.custbut:hover,#custbut:hover,.wpcf7-form-control,#leaveAreview .custbut:hover,.blog article .btn:hover{
	color:black;	background-color:#bfbfbf;
}

/* alt heading font */
.custfont{
font-family: 'Oswald', sans-serif;	letter-spacing:1.5px;
	font-weight:700;text-transform:uppercase;
}

h1.custfont{
	font-size:1.9rem;
	color:#0E4883;
margin:0px 0px 0px 0px;
}
 

h1,h2,h2.custfont.alt, custfont.alt{
	color:#0E4883;
	font-size:1.6rem;
	font-weight:600;
font-family: 'Oswald', sans-serif;	letter-spacing:1.5px;

}

/* custom breakout */

.breakout.content {
	display:flex;
	align-items:center;
	justify-content:center;
	min-height:500px;
}

/* custom cards */

.breakout .cards{
 	text-align:center;
	padding:0rem 1rem;
	position:relative;
	display:flex;
	flex-direction:row;
	align-items:center;
	padding: 2rem 1.5em;
	justify-content:center;
	min-height:450px;
	transition:all ease .25s;
	background-color:rgba(0,0,0,.4);
	margin-bottom:0px;
}
.breakout .cards a{position:absolute;width:100%;height:100%;}

.breakout .cards a:hover{text-decoration:none !important}

#cardrow .row div{
	background-position:center;
	transition: all ease .2s;
		background-size:100% auto;	
	position:relative;
}

#cardrow .row div:hover{
		background-size:115% auto;	
}

.breakout .cards:hover{
	background-color:rgba(0,0,0,.6);
}
/* custom forms layout for clinet */
.page-reviews #content{
	position:relative;
	min-height:80vh;
	height:auto;
	margin-bottom:0rem;padding:0rem;
	background:#D6DEE3;
	min-height:100vh;
}

.page-reviews form{
	width:100%;
	height:100%;
}	


.goblue{background-color:#0E4883;}


@media only screen and (min-width: 768px) {
	.nav-bar ul li.lg-sub ul.sub-menu {
		left: 0;
		right: auto;
		min-width: 400px;
		column-count: 2;
	}
}